What the book is doing
Hargrave Jennings's "Phallic Worship" is a late 19th-century scholarly exploration into the historical and symbolic significance of sex worship and phallicism across ancient civilizations. The book meticulously traces the presence of phallic veneration from its perceived pure origins as fertility cults to its later manifestations in complex religious rites and societal norms. Jennings argues that these practices were deeply intertwined with human understanding of nature, reproduction, and divinity, evolving through various cultures including Hebrew, Egyptian, Greek, and Indian traditions. The work aims to elucidate the underlying philosophy and widespread prevalence of these often-misunderstood ancient mysteries, presenting phallicism as a foundational element of early religious thought that often became corrupted by priesthoods seeking power.
Key Themes
Phallicism as Primordial Religion
Jennings posits that the veneration of the phallus, representing the generative principle, was the earliest and most fundamental form of human worship. He argues that this was a natural and pure acknowledgment of life-giving forces, preceding more complex theological systems. This theme is central to the entire book, serving as its foundational premise for interpreting ancient faiths.
The Evolution and Corruption of Rites
Jennings traces a trajectory from what he considers the 'pure' and 'innocent' origins of phallic worship to its later 'corruption' and 'degeneration'. He suggests that as societies grew more complex, and particularly with the rise of organized priesthoods, the original, open veneration of nature's generative power became esoteric, ritualized, and often exploited for social control or personal gain, leading to secret, sometimes debauched, practices.
